Bullying in Schools:

What can we expect?


A 19 page pdf document written for Australian parents of children with disabilities, this document is written in plain language to support parents in understanding laws, policies and practices in Australian schools with regards to bullying.

Contents:
  • Introduction (fact and figures)
  • Laws, Standards and Policies
  • Finding Common Ground: Understanding different perspecitves on bullying
  • Reporting bullying
  • Responding to bullying
  • Preventing bullying
  • Not satisfied? (contacts outside the school)
  • Useful websites
  • Reference list

Is it Really Bullying?

 

This is a pdf document based on the topic of discussion in a workshop presented to the Autism and Aspergers Support Group. The aim of this booklet is to help parents and teachers understand the needs and motivations of all children involved in a bullying incident and more effectively respond to and change the children's behaviour.
